T-52 LONG RANGE AUXILIARY FUEL SYSTEM

All new Engineering for MD369 and 500/500N/600/600N/Explorer Helicopters Aux. Fuel Systems

Specifications

Capacity: 52 U.S. Gallons

Weight: 93Lbs (42kg.)

Shipping Weight: 213 Lbs. (97kg.)

Fuel Pump: Twin Electrical

V NE Reduction: None

Approved On: All MD 500 and 500N, 369,  series helicopters FAA STC SH667NW

T-52 LONG RANGE AUXILIARY FUEL SYSTEM has been in service for thirty years. It has a protective, strong, stress resistant casing and F.A.A. quality approved components. These units are literally crafted to completion and rigidly inspected for long life and complete safety. A quality product from Tower Aerospace Inc., Nelson, British Columbia, Canada.

 

Tank

  • 52 U.S. Gallons Double Shell Composite Construction
  • Doubles as Rear Passenger Seat
  • External Fill Located Above Existing Filler Well
  • Internally Baffled to Prevent Sloshing and Increase Strength
  • Twin Fuel Pumps Provide 25 GPH Individually – 50 GPH Combined
  • External Pre-Flight Drain

 

Pumps

Twin pumps are provided which individually pump at approximately 30 GPH –  together 60 GPH enabling any combination of transfer required.

 

Installation

  • Initial Installation 8 Hours
  • Subsequent Installations 1 Hour
  • Installation Kit Contains All Required Hardware, Including a State of the Art

Digital Control Panel and Fuel Indication

  • Permanent Hardware Kit Available to Enable One Tank Unit to Service  Several Helicopters

 

Pre-Flight Drain

Independent pre-flight drain to assure no contaminants  enter primary tank, to be checked prior to each flight.

 

Plumbing

Outlet is plumbed directly to the filler of the main tank.

Accessibility

System is designed to allow any normal maintenance
-100 hr. and 300hr. inspections without removal of tank.

Ease of fuel pump system maintenance and inspection is accomplished by an access panel in the side of the tank. Fuel system does not need to be drained to change the pumps.

 

Electrical

Console located switch box is provided complete with push to start/stop switches, circuit breaker, fuel quantity gauge, and power lights.

 

Vent

All vent and drain lines double-jacketed. Any overfill spills go outside of fuselage.

 

Testing

  • FAA Drop Tower Tested In Four Positions
  • Expansion Space, Sump Space, Flow Rates and Vent System Tested From
  • 20,000 Ft in Maximum Auto-rotation
  • Pressure Tested
  • Immersion Tested
  • Fluid Volume Tested
  • Electrical Operating and Measuring Systems Tested

 

Optional Equipment

Custom seat cushions to match interiors or custom made interiors

Documentation

Each System Ships With A Comprehensive Owners Manual Containing the

Following Documents:

 

  • Installation Drawings
  • Installation Instructions
  • Operating Instructions
  • Maintenance Instructions
  • FAA STC
  • Approved Flight Manual Supplement
  • Weight And Balance Data
  • Parts List
  • 12 Month Warranty
